It's about building a community, for either roleplay, PVP, town building, commerce. Etc.. or all of the above. Which is the ideal approach. IE roleplay building a town, filling it with citizens, those citizens finding their place in it (fighters, crafters, merchants, gatherers, etc..), defending it, expanding it, and holding on to it. That's the game, and it can be very compelling with the right type of players.
So to say a game like this has no "endgame" I just find a little funny, as to me it's true endgame, as it's wide open, and built for it, that's what all of these systems are for. It's not just a gear treadmill like so many games are in this genre.

Seems many people overlook the Loyalty point system, with which everyone can purchase many convenience items (like carry-weight increases). Granted, those prices are high as well, but they are essentially free...as long as you play the game. I really hope Daum does listen to the player-customers, but this seems to be the way the business model has evolved. If enough people can restrain themselves from spending hundreds of dollars in the first month or two while the experience is fresh and everyone is in the "honeymoon" stage, then maybe we can drive down the prices a little.
